Backtesting a number of markets on the similar time has a number of advantages.
The brief model is that you’re going to save time and you’ll take a look at based mostly on market correlations.
This course of will probably be just like backtesting a number of timeframes on the similar time, however would require a few extra setups.
Backtesting a number of markets is simple with an automatic technique.
Simply run the buying and selling program in opposition to information from totally different markets.
However viewing a number of markets on the similar time shouldn’t be as simple with guide testing.
On this fast tutorial I will provide the advantages and drawbacks of guide a number of market backtesting and precisely how one can do it.
Advantages of Backtesting A number of Markets Concurrently
Should you already learn about the advantages of backtesting a number of markets, skip all the way down to the part on setups.
However for those who aren’t certain why you must do it, listed below are the highest 2 causes.
Save Time
First, testing a number of markets can prevent a ton of time.
For example that you simply wish to manually backtest a buying and selling technique on the EURUSD and the S&P500 on the similar time.
Moreover, as an example that testing every market individually will take you 2 days.
Should you run each charts on the similar time and take trades on each charts, it’d solely take 2.5 days to do your take a look at as an alternative of 4 days.
This can be a big profit.
See Market Correlations
The opposite purpose to backtest a number of markets on the similar time is to see market correlations.
For instance, a ceaselessly talked about correlation is between the CADJPY and Oil.
Since Canada is a serious oil exporter and Japan imports all of its oil, the worth of oil can impact every economic system accordingly.
As at all times, do not take my phrase for it, backtest it your self.
There are numerous different market dynamics at play with regard to foreign money costs, so the worth of oil is not at all times going to be the most important affect.
However if you wish to take a look at this, it may be robust to see the correlation (or lack thereof) if you’re solely backtesting one market at a time.
Having each charts aspect by aspect makes this simple.
Downsides of Backtesting A number of Markets Concurrently
A number of market backtesting shouldn’t be all sunshine and unicorns although.
This is what you have to be conscious of if you are going to do that.
Lack of Focus
One potential draw back is that you would miss some indicators, when you have too many markets open on the similar time.
So if you wish to take a look at on a number of markets, it’s a must to be tremendous targeted.
It is very easy to overlook trades when you will have a number of charts going on the similar time.
I’d counsel not testing greater than 3 markets on the similar time…max.
Two markets is good.
Laptop Sluggish Down
In case you have too many markets open on the similar time, this could additionally decelerate your pc.
Your buying and selling program should replace the information for every chart and in addition calculate your indicators (for those who’re utilizing any).
Relying on how highly effective your pc is, and which backtesting software program you are utilizing, this would possibly gradual issues down.
So make certain that you will have an honest pc and software program that may deal with this.
A very powerful spec on a pc goes to be the quantity of RAM you will have.
Processor velocity does contribute to the general velocity, however so long as you will have a processor made within the final 5 years, you will see means extra positive aspects from RAM.
At the least 16GB is really helpful, however 32 GB or extra is good.
Find out how to Setup a Backtest in A number of Markets
Alright, now that you’ve some background on multi-market guide backtesting let’s get into truly how to do that.
I’ve personally achieved this with NakedMarkets and Foreign exchange Tester, however it will work in the same means in different applications.
In case your software program can’t do that, I’d extremely counsel switching to NakedMarkets.
This software program is far more optimized for a number of market backtesting than Foreign exchange Tester.
I will use NakedMarkets for the remainder of this tutorial as a result of that is what I take advantage of.
Step 1: Obtain Historic Information
You are going to want some information to check with, so step one is to go to: Instruments > Information Middle and obtain historic information for the markets you wish to take a look at.
NakedMarkets offers up to date historic information without cost, no subscription wanted.
Step 3: Setup the Backtest
As soon as the information is loaded, it is time to add your charts and set them up.
Go to: File > New Backtest
Title your backtest and the beginning steadiness for the account.
Then click on Subsequent.
The select the markets you wish to backtest. You’ll want to choose multiple market on this display screen.
Click on on Subsequent.
Use the default settings on the final display screen and click on on End.
Now a window for every market will open.
Resize the home windows to your liking.
If it is advisable to add extra home windows, click on on: File > Add New Chart and choose the chart you wish to add.
You may solely have the ability to add markets that you simply chosen while you created the backtest.
Needless to say it’s also possible to have a number of timeframes for every market.
Merely add one other chart for every market, then change the timeframe of the second chart.
You may as well change the timeframe of every chart by clicking on the chart you wish to change, then clicking on the timeframe buttons within the higher left nook of the display screen.
As soon as your entire charts are setup, it is time to begin backtesting!
Step 4: Press Play and Begin Taking Trades
The exhausting half is completed, now it is time to begin testing.
Press the play button in your software program and it’ll advance your entire charts on the similar velocity.
Take trades in keeping with your buying and selling plan.
Step 5: Overview Your Outcomes
As soon as you’ve got accomplished a full spherical of backtesting, it is time to see how nicely you probably did.
A standard mistake is to evaluate a buying and selling technique purely on its whole return.
Professionals study in any respect points of a method to establish its potential as a result of most methods will not have good outcomes on the primary strive.
There are 3 principal questions that you must ask your self when reviewing your backtesting outcomes:
- Can I presumably enhance this technique? That is often potential when a method is close to breakeven. Think about experimenting together with your threat administration or exits.
- Can I probably commerce this on totally different timeframes or in a number of markets on the similar time? This may give you extra trades, if lack of trades is your drawback.
- Is the general development of account steadiness good? In case your technique wins constantly, however has a low total return, then you definitely would possibly merely want to extend your threat.
Learn extra about how one can optimize your methods on this article.
Be keen to experiment together with your technique till you discover one thing that works.
That is the great thing about backtesting.
You may get a good suggestion of what works BEFORE you truly threat actual cash.
There may be additionally a artistic component, which makes it enjoyable to check out new concepts that you simply give you.
Conclusion
In order that’s why and how one can manually backtest your buying and selling methods in a number of markets on the similar time.
Should you’ve been testing one market at a time, this is usually a recreation changer.
It’s going to let you discover worthwhile buying and selling methods and get rid of losers sooner.
Completely satisfied testing!